Abstract
The GLC data and model concepts showed that the breaking effect of C-3-C-5 alkanols on nematic structures of p-alkanoyloxy-p'-nitroazoxybenzenes (R = C3H7 C5H11, C7H15) is determined by stability of the intermolecular H-bonde d complexes mesogen-nonmesogen and by orientation of the bound mesomorphic substance. The limiting slopes of the boundaries of the phase equilibria ne matic phase-isotropic liquid correlate with the partial molar enthalpies an d entropies of solution of alcohols in the mesomorphic structures at infini te dilution.
